Top 10 HTTP Client and Web Debugging Proxy Tools (2023)
Charles Proxy is another tool that has a good popularity. It is a web proxy i.e., HTTP proxy or HTTP monitor that runs on your computer. Compared to Paw which works on only macOS, Charles proxy if configured or run correctly is agreeable with all OS, web browsers, any smart devices, personal computers, and internet applications.
12 HTTP Client and Web Debugging Proxy Tools
As the name says, Charles proxy is an HTTP and reverse proxy. It works by routing local traffic through it.

Comparing Charles Proxy, Fiddler, Wireshark, and Requestly
Although thousands of developers around the globe use Wireshark and Charles Proxy, they fail to occupy the top side in the design aspect. Wireshark’s interface is robust and detailed but can be intimidating for beginners. While Charles Proxy has a more approachable interface compared to Wireshark, it might seem cluttered to some users.
